Output 1288318071556953bcaf49d599c698a8bb769a2b44eb34e01be3108362c3dcc1:0

value
673740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fd3875d6bbfb1807eb19be9f7335c481e65590 OP_EQUAL
address
31xpczvht6pn86AhiFmSnhevagqpH7kNvy
transaction
1288318071556953bcaf49d599c698a8bb769a2b44eb34e01be3108362c3dcc1
spent
false